Cardinal Resting After Slip & Fall

The Cardinal is recuperating at his home, recovering from a fractured femur he suffered after a slip and fall at a Northwest Side Church on Monday.

The Archdiocese says the Cardinal will continue to rest and take it easy while maintaining his regular work schedule from his home, although, all of his public appearances in the immediate future will be rescheduled or postponed.

A camera caught the scene as the Cardinal slipped and fell on Holy water on the marble church floor, during a blessing of Easter food baskets. The Cardinal, a polio survivor, wears a brace on his leg and has suffered a fall before. This time though, fracturing his femur, forcing him to miss Easter mass.

The cardinal was treated after the fall at Loyola University Medical Center in Maywood.
